The EU-Zambia Business Forum: "Growing the Copper Industry through sustainable value chains" took place in Zambia from the 10-12 April 2024.
The forum brought together Zambian and European businesses with the aim of forging corporate partnerships and facilitate a dialogue around attracting finance, upscaling through the copper value-chain, and realising the potentials of circular economy, in order to strengthen the EU-Zambia copper-trade.
The Forum builds on a study commissioned by the EU, on the various opportunities for expanding and enforcing the EU-Zambia copper-trade.
In essence, the study uncovered no less than 9 different areas with under-utilised potential for expanding and growing the Zambian copper-industry, which can largely be separated into three categories:
o Upstream opportunities (though not exploration and extraction)
o Downstream opportunities
o Opportunities within circular economy relating to re-processing and selling by-products from copper mining
Therefore, the EU hosted a business forum in collaboration with relevant local partners, that aimed to forge EU-Zambian business partnerships to begin realising these opportunities, as well as igniting a series of dialogues around important issues such as:
o ESG regulations and its implications for EU-Zambian investments and other financial agreements
o Business development in Zambia
o Potential investment-barriers and how to overcome them
The program contained a mixture of panel-debates, keynote talks, but importantly also individual Business-to-Business meetings.
